Exploring the potential exploits of CVE-2026-2297 in SourcelessFileLoader and its implications for secure code execution.
CVE-2026-2297 highlights a fundamental oversight in the SourcelessFileLoader's design, specifically its failure to implement the io.open_code() function, a critical safeguard in the realm of secure code execution. This oversight does not merely represent a technical misstep but underscores a potential attack path that threat actors could exploit to execute arbitrary code. The absence of proper control mechanisms invites the very chaos that defenders strive to prevent. It is essential to recognize that vulnerabilities like this one are not theoretical artifacts but practical opportunities for attackers eager to manipulate execution environments.
Examining the implications of CVE-2026-2297 reveals a concerning narrative. As attackers increasingly hone their skills, they are likely to investigate this loophole rigorously, aiming to exploit it in various environments where SourcelessFileLoader is deployed. The failure to utilize io.open_code() not only undermines code integrity but also weakens the boundaries that typically contain execution paths. For defenders, this means ramping up awareness and defensive strategies to mitigate risk as this vulnerability becomes documented and potentially weaponized.
The exploitability of this vulnerability is alarmingly high. Attackers could craft payloads that, once executed through the SourcelessFileLoader, bypass existing security measures and run malicious commands within target environments. This kind of exploitation can lead to full system compromise, especially if paired with already existing privileges within a victim's architecture. The potential for lateral movement is significant, as attackers leverage the initial foothold established through this vulnerability to escalate privileges or pivot to more sensitive applications and systems.
Defenders must approach CVE-2026-2297 with a mindset anchored in proactive control measures. Rigorous code auditing should be prioritized, particularly for applications relying on SourcelessFileLoader. The incorporation of industry-best practices in secure coding can also help mitigate similar vulnerabilities in the future. Regular penetration testing could uncover exploitable weaknesses related to the failure of io.open_code(), allowing organizations to address these issues before they become widespread. Simultaneously, the deployment of robust monitoring solutions can assist in detecting unauthorized code executions early, empowering defenders to respond to active threats more swiftly.
In the context of application security and the dynamics of exploit development, CVE-2026-2297 serves as a stark reminder that overlooked nuances can lead to significant vulnerabilities. The lack of controls around code execution not only invites potential exploitation but also calls for an examination of existing protocols surrounding code safely within environments dependent on this loader. As this vulnerability garners more attention, the onus will be on organizations to demonstrate their commitment to effective vulnerability management. In a landscape where attackers are consistently looking for gaps, defenders must step up their game, deploying effective controls and staying ahead of the adversary. The lesson here is clear: if there’s an overlooked vulnerability, it will eventually be exploited, underscoring the necessity of vigilance and rapid response planning.
In conclusion, CVE-2026-2297 is more than a simple coding oversight; it represents a tangible risk in the cybersecurity landscape. The failure to implement io.open_code() in the SourcelessFileLoader creates a fertile ground for exploitation, posing direct challenges that organizations must confront with seriousness and agility. As the potential implications of this vulnerability become clear and exploitation scenarios emerge, the time for defenders to fortify their defenses is now. The landscape of vulnerabilities is ever-evolving, and the threat posed by such overlooked security practices cannot be underestimated. The message is unambiguous: vigilance and proactive control mechanisms are essential to maintain resilience in an ever-increasingly hostile cyber environment.